This is what I what to do: 

In a notes application i want to generate one PDF from x number of
documents ( takes the content in two field  in every doc and write it to
the pdf).

I have almost managed to do that. My problem is that I just get "plane
text" .. one of the fields I take from the notes document is a
richtextfield and I would like to have the exact content of the field.
The field can contain tables, different fonts, bullet lists ...   and I
would like all that written to the PDF .  

 

I just can't figure out how..  att the moment I do like this to write to
my pdf : 

 

document.add(new Paragraph( doc.getItemValueString("QDoc") + "\n\n",
FontFactory.getFont(FontFactory.HELVETICA, 10)));

            

doc is my notesdocument and QDoc is the name of the field.
